APLIKASI PENGAMAN RUANGAN DENGAN TEKNOLOGI LASER RANGEFINDER MENGGUNAKAN WEBCAM DAN LASER CLASS 2 Amalia Puspita Sari

Abstract

One of the primary needs of the people is secure. It required every person, family, neighborhood, office, organizations, political parties and the state. so the author of the study final test by making an Security Application of the Room by Using Technology Laser Rangefinder Using Webcam and Laser Class 2 Devices. These applications are built using waterfall process model, which is one of the software process model that has five workflows: requirements definition, system and software design, implementation and unit testing, integration and system testing, operation and maintenance. The system was developed with the framework Visual Studio 2010, C # language and technology laser rangefinder that is implemented with the support of webcam and laser class 2 devices.
HUBUNGAN TEKNIK MENERAN DENGAN KEJADIAN RUPTUR PERINEUM PADA PRIMIGRAVIDA DI POLINDES SAYANG IBU (Kecamatan Dawar Blandong Mojokerto) Evi Yunita Nugrahini; Susilorini .; Amalia Puspita Sari

Abstract

Rupture of the perineum is still a problem, because there are many maternal primigravid obtained by perineal rupture caused by various factors, one of them is a straining technique. Based on preliminary studies conducted in Polindes Sayang Ibu kecamatan Dawar Blandong Mojokerto of 50 primigravida who labor, 60% experienced a rupture perineum with wrong staining technical factors. Given these problems it will be examined staining technical relationship with rupture of the perineum in primigravida.The method used is analitk with cross sectional approach with population of 30 maternity primigravida delivered in Polindes Sayang Ibu kecamatan Dawar Blandong Mojokerto at the time that the research conducted in March-July with a sample of 28 maternal primigravida. Concecutive sampling technique used by counting all the existing number of samples. The independent variable of this study is straining technique and the dependent variable in this study is the rupture of the perineum. Collecting data using observation sheets, then analyzed and statistically tested by chi-square test with significance level = 0.05.The results showed that of the 28 maternal primigravid obtained the majority (57%) do straining technique properly and most (57.2%) also maternal primigravid ruptured perineum. Data analysis was performed with chi-square test of SPSS result of count = 10.22 using a significance level (α) = 5% (0.05), df = 1 Found a critical point  ( table ) = 3.84 in order to obtain count (10.22) table (3.84), then H1 is acceptedThe conclusion from the above results there is a correlation staining technique to rupture perineum in Polindes Sayang Ibu kecamatan Dawar Blandong Mojokerto. It is therefore expected health workers can provide counseling about the manner of delivery with the correct straining techniques and delivery complications, so primigravida could do straining technique right at the birth took place. Keywords: Straining technique, Rupture of the perineum.
Synthesis of Red Fruit Oil (Pandanus Conoideus) Emulsion with Tween 80 Surfactant and Alginate Co-Surfactant Indriyani, Nita; Ramadhani, Layli Putri; Muzdalifah, Nirmalani; Sari, Amalia Puspita; Fathurrahman, F.

Abstract

Red fruit (pandanus conoideus) is one of the natural biological resources that contains lipid compounds that are beneficial and important for health. However, the content of red fruit oil components is sensitive to oxygen, light, and heat, so it impacts damage to the content and a relatively short shelf life. The emulsification method can increase the benefits and shelf life of red fruit oil. Emulsions can be stored by preserving active substances in their core and protecting them with a shell layer. Adding alginate to the water phase can increase the stability of the emulsion against aggregation because these molecules can cause steric and electrostatic repulsion between droplet interfaces. This study aims to synthesize red fruit oil emulsions with alginate as a co-surfactant. The variables observed were the ratio of ingredients, the effect of speed, and the time of emulsification stirring. The study's results, namely alginate, can be used as a co-surfactant in the synthesis of red fruit oil emulsions. The ratio of red fruit oil emulsion ingredients is 1% weight/volume, tween 80 1% weight/volume, and alginate 2% weight/volume of a total volume of 40 ml. The emulsification process conditions were carried out at room temperature with a stirring speed of 25,000 rpm and a stirring time of 10 minutes. The resulting emulsion is an oil-in-water emulsion (m/a). The emulsion is dominated by hydrophilic or polar components caused by tween 80 surfactants and alginate co-surfactants. In addition, the creaming formation time occurred after 216 hours, and the separation time occurred after storage for 552 hours.
